Submit Your Work for the 37th Annual Oklahoma Book Awards

Authors, poets, illustrators, photographers, and book designers with an Oklahoma connection are invited to enter the 37th Annual Oklahoma Book Awards. Eligible titles must be published in 2025 and either feature Oklahoma or be created by someone who lives—or has lived—in the state.

Entries open October 15, 2025, and close January 7, 2026. Each submission requires an entry form, six copies of the book, and a $25 fee per category.

The awards are presented by the Oklahoma Center for the Book, which celebrates and promotes Oklahoma’s rich literary heritage. 

Categories

  • Fiction
  • Non-Fiction
  • Children/Young Adult
  • Book Design/Illustration/Photography
  • Poetry

Eligibility

Any individual, organization, or company may submit an entry in one or more categories. Books must have an Oklahoma-based theme, or the entrant (author, illustrator, photographer, or book designer) must live or have lived in Oklahoma. Eligible titles are those published between January 1 and December 31, 2025. Hardcover and paperback works are accepted, but books entered in previous Oklahoma Book Award competitions are not eligible. All entries must be received by the deadline to be considered. Important Dates

The call for entries opens on October 15, 2025, and the deadline for submissions is January 7, 2026. Finalists will be announced in Spring 2026, and the Awards Ceremony will also take place later that spring.

The Oklahoma Center for the Book (OCB) has partnered with the non-profit Friends of the Oklahoma Center for the Book for more than 30 years to co-sponsor the annual Oklahoma Book Awards.

The OCB, located in the Oklahoma Department of Libraries, is affiliated with the National Center for the Book in the Library of Congress. 

The Center’s mission is to promote Oklahoma authors, celebrate the state’s literary heritage, encourage reading for pleasure by Oklahomans.
